Electrical installations in hazardous areas demand specialized knowledge, strict safety protocols, and adherence to industry regulations to prevent accidents such as explosions or equipment failures. Industries like oil and gas, chemical processing, and mining frequently operate in such environments, requiring precise classification, equipment selection, and operational procedures.
